The chiral critical locus and topological structures

arXiv:2403.03630

Abstract

We study a differential graded VOA associated to the derived critical locus of a function on a smooth oriented -dimensional variety . Informally, this VOA, , is just the algebra of chiral differential operators on the derived critical locus . We prove, using a generalization of a physical construction of Witten, the admits a \emph{topological structure} if is homogeneous for a action on . If has weight and has weight , we compute the rank of the topological structure in terms of the discrete invariants of the theory to be We conclude with some remarks about BV quantization and a simple computation of characters.
